Installation Notes and Tips
When installing the Bendix Friction ProSpec Brake Rotor PRT5566, ensure the rotor surface is clean and free of rust or debris before mounting. It is recommended to inspect brake pads and replace them if worn to maintain optimal braking performance. Proper torque specifications should be followed when securing the rotor to avoid warping. Always verify compatibility with your specific vehicle model and year.

This part fits 15 vehicles. Search below:
| Year | Make | Model | Submodel | Position |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010 | Mazda | Tribute |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2010 | Mercury | Mariner |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2009 | Mazda | Tribute |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2009 | Mercury | Mariner |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2008 | Ford | Escape |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2008 | Mazda | Tribute |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2008 | Mercury | Mariner |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2007 | Ford | Escape | Hybrid |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or |
| 2007 | Mercury | Mariner |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2006 | Ford | Escape |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2006 | Mazda | Tribute |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2006 | Mercury | Mariner |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2005 | Ford | Escape |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2005 | Mazda | Tribute |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or | |
| 2005 | Mercury | Mariner | Rear | ProSpec Brake Rotor |
* Always verify fitment with your vehicle's VIN if unsure. Submodel & trim restrictions may apply.
